What Causes Recovery from Physical Stress?
Repetitive microtrauma from intense training or demanding physical occupations creates cumulative damage to tendons, ligaments, cartilage, and muscle tissue that outpaces the body's natural repair capacity over time.
Chronic systemic inflammation driven by intense exercise, inadequate recovery periods, and accumulated tissue damage creates a persistent inflammatory state that impairs tissue repair and accelerates musculoskeletal wear.
Overtraining syndrome, where the volume and intensity of physical demands consistently exceed recovery capacity, leads to hormonal disruption, immune suppression, and progressive decline in performance and tissue health.
Age-related decline in regenerative capacity means that recovery from the same physical demands takes progressively longer, and tissue repair becomes less complete with each passing year.
Nutritional deficiencies and metabolic demands of intense physical activity may deplete the substrates required for tissue repair, including amino acids, micronutrients, and the growth factors necessary for effective healing.
Common Signs and Symptoms
Persistent muscle soreness and joint stiffness that no longer fully resolves between training sessions or work periods, reflecting accumulated tissue damage that the body cannot repair quickly enough.
Declining performance metrics despite maintained or increased training volume, indicating that the body's regenerative capacity is not keeping pace with the demands being placed upon it.
Recurrent overuse injuries including tendinopathy, stress reactions, and muscle strains that flare repeatedly in the same areas, suggesting incomplete healing of the underlying tissue damage.
Prolonged recovery times where bouncing back from intense physical efforts takes significantly longer than it used to, with fatigue and soreness persisting for days rather than hours.
Sleep disruption and persistent fatigue despite adequate rest periods, reflecting the systemic impact of chronic inflammation and the metabolic cost of incomplete tissue repair.
Mood changes, reduced motivation, and decreased enjoyment of physical activity that may signal overtraining and the neurological impact of chronic physical stress.

Conventional Treatment Options
Conventional approaches to physical stress recovery include periodised training programmes, structured rest and recovery protocols, physiotherapy, massage, cryotherapy, and non-steroidal anti-inflammatory drugs (NSAIDs). Corticosteroid injections may be used for persistent tendinopathy or joint inflammation but risk tissue weakening with repeated use. Platelet-rich plasma is sometimes offered but evidence for its efficacy remains mixed. Nutritional optimisation, sleep hygiene, and stress management form the foundation of recovery strategies. While these approaches are valuable, they fundamentally rely on the body's existing regenerative capacity, which declines with age and accumulated damage. For high-performance individuals whose physical demands consistently exceed their recovery capacity, conventional methods reach a ceiling, driving interest in regenerative approaches that may enhance the body's tissue repair mechanisms at the cellular level.
